Stellar Evolution
From the enigmatic nebulae, stars are born. These celestial giants ignite through stellar combustion, transforming hydrogen into helium and emitting incredible amounts of energy. Over billions of years, stars transform, click here their durations determined by their gravity. Smaller stars fade into white specters, while massive stars culminate in spectacular supernovae, scattering elements and forging new stellar populations. The ultimate fate of many stars is to collapse into compact voids, where gravity reigns supreme.
- Stars shine brightly, providing light and warmth to their planetary systems. Planets orbit around stars, some within the habitable zone where liquid water may exist. The study of stellar evolution provides insights into the origins and fate of our own solar system.
